Is the fan moving air correctly? the air just cools off? Check the heater hoses, if they're both hot, then the air flow is blocked, if one is hot and one is cold, the coolant side of the heater core is blocked. Maybe just remove the heater hoses and blow backwards with air, coolant into a can, then garden hose and more air until it comes clean. No telling what's been added to that cooling system, the heater core is the "filter".
